Section 2: Practical Applications in Business and Industry

The applications of Key Indicator Data Visualization are vast and diverse, spanning multiple industries and sectors. In healthcare, data visualization can be used to track patient outcomes, disease trends, and treatment efficacy, enabling healthcare professionals to make data-driven decisions. In finance, data visualization can help analysts and investors identify market trends, track portfolio performance, and make informed investment decisions. A notable example is the use of data visualization in the COVID-19 pandemic response, where dashboards and visualizations were used to track infection rates, hospitalization rates, and vaccination efforts, facilitating a coordinated global response. For example, the COVID-19 Dashboard created by the Johns Hopkins University Center for Systems Science and Engineering, which provides a real-time visualization of the pandemic's spread, is a testament to the power of data visualization in crisis management.
